About time too - the wonderous Edward Scissorhands gets a Movie Maniac Makeover .Based on the Tim Burton film Edward Scissorhands, played by actor Johnny Depp.This magical tale in an alternate universe of small town USA brings a story of an young man, who was created by an inventor, who died before Edward were to receive his human hands. Now part of the Movie Maniacs, Edward features a very intricate design with several moving scissors and unique hair. Edward stands 7" tall with 9 points of articulation and comes with movie poster display. close up of Edward Scissorhands |

A crazed scientist, played by actor Jeff Goldblum, test himself in a genetic transporter machine. He accidentally miscalculates and start the transformation process into the Fly! Now part of the Movie Maniacs, the Fly features a remarkable likeness to the 1986 film creature. The Fly stands 6" tall with 10 points of articulation. Comes packaged, custom drool base and movie poster display. Big juicy Brundlefly, with gungey bits and vomit inducing appearance. Brilliant! Fly view |

Mad Ash gets Dead Evil in this McFarlane figure from Hell. Ash is the star of the best goriest low budget film ever made, Evil Dead. With popularity of this cult classic it spawned Evil Dead 2 and Army of Darkness all directed by Sam Raimi. Bruce Campbell (Xena, Jack of all Trades) plays Ash. After requests and several petition by fans of the film and the toy series, Ash has made it to the big time. Ash stands 6 7/8" tall with 8 points of articulation and comes packaged with mini-Evil Ash, shotgun, chainsaw, gauntlet glove, book of the dead and movie poster display. Ash close up

Rock hard Snake escapes from McFarlanes drawingboard at last. The one-eyed action hero has plans to save the world in the 1996 film Escape from L.A. Coerced into the mission, Snake travels to Los Angles which in 2013 is now a maximum security prison. Snake Plissken played by actor Kurt Russell, has 10 hours to find the doomsday weapon and find a cure to an injected virus. Now part of the Movie Maniacs, Snake Plissken features a remarkable likeness to the 1996 film character. Snake stands 6" tall with 7 points of articulation and comes with eye patch, holster, two handguns, shotgun and removable overcoat. Packaged with movie poster display

John Carpenter's 1982 remake The Thing features an all out gore fest with some of the best special effects seen on film. An alien spacecraft found under an artic research station deploys a creature capable of taking any living form. A blood splattered film filled with gore and body fluids has fans still talking about this one Now part of the Movie Maniacs, the Blair Monster features a remarkable likeness to the 1982 film creature. Blair Monster stands 7" tall and features 11 points of articulation and comes with movie poster display. Adorable, in a stomach churny kinda way. |

Norris gets his thingy in a twist.John Carpenter's 1982 remake The Thing features an all out gore fest with some of the best special effects seen on film. An alien spacecraft found under an artic research station deploys a creature capable of taking any living form. A blood splattered film filled with gore and body fluids has fans still talking about this one. Now part of the Movie Maniacs, the Norris Creature features a remarkable likeness to the 1982 film creature. Norris Creature stand 6" tall with 9 points of articulation and comes with the six legged Norris Spider. Packaged with movie poster display. Norris Spider
